Output 5dbe78283920aed39b4da3cea84c5ad5c5017945f38720538d4e07220611281f:1

value
346241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db003a014a7700d75de9174e88b82e0d0495abc4 OP_EQUAL
address
3MezBJE8THhamTCvj8jtNQ8EEZotowq94H
transaction
5dbe78283920aed39b4da3cea84c5ad5c5017945f38720538d4e07220611281f
confirmations
49363
spent
true